The diagonal of a rectangle is 34 cm. If its breadth is 16 cm, find its :
(i) length (ii) area

To solve the problem step by step, we will find the length of the rectangle first and then calculate its area. ### Step 1: Understand the Problem We are given: - Diagonal (D) = 34 cm - Breadth (B) = 16 cm We need to find: (i) Length (L) (ii) Area of the rectangle ### Step 2: Use the Pythagorean Theorem In a rectangle, the diagonal, length, and breadth form a right triangle. According to the Pythagorean theorem: \[ D^2 = L^2 + B^2 \] ### Step 3: Substitute the Known Values Substituting the values of D and B into the equation: \[ 34^2 = L^2 + 16^2 \] ### Step 4: Calculate the Squares Calculate \( 34^2 \) and \( 16^2 \): - \( 34^2 = 1156 \) - \( 16^2 = 256 \) Now substitute these values into the equation: \[ 1156 = L^2 + 256 \] ### Step 5: Solve for Length (L) Rearranging the equation to find \( L^2 \): \[ L^2 = 1156 - 256 \] \[ L^2 = 900 \] Now take the square root of both sides to find L: \[ L = \sqrt{900} \] \[ L = 30 \, \text{cm} \] ### Step 6: Calculate the Area The area (A) of a rectangle is given by the formula: \[ A = L \times B \] Substituting the values of L and B: \[ A = 30 \times 16 \] ### Step 7: Perform the Multiplication Calculating the area: \[ A = 480 \, \text{cm}^2 \] ### Final Answers (i) Length = 30 cm (ii) Area = 480 cm² ---
